Liánhuāshān (Lotus Hill) Range Rear Lighthouse

6s🇨🇳CNOperational

The Liánhuāshān (Lotus Hill) Range Rear light is a white, square pyramidal skeletal tower constructed from concrete. It stands 23 meters tall, with the focal plane at 24 meters above sea level. This range light provides guidance from its position 1.5 kilometers from the nearest port. The light characteristic is derived from its front counterpart. It has a geographic range of 14.1 nautical miles.

Which ports and harbors does Liánhuāshān (Lotus Hill) Range Rear Lighthouse guide vessels into?+
Liánhuāshān (Lotus Hill) Range Rear Lighthouse assists vessels approaching 5 nearby ports. The closest is Shilou at 1.1 NM to the NNW. Other ports served include Lianhuashan Pt (1.4 NM S), MCID (1.5 NM NE), Lijiang (2.6 NM S), Xinsha (3 NM ESE). Mariners should consult the relevant chart for full approach and pilotage information.
